菜单重定向仅转到带有代码点火器的索引.php页面


Menu redirects only go to the index.php page with codeigniter

Codeigniter对我来说是第一个,所以我希望我的解释很清楚。在这种情况下,我正在处理在不同的服务器上设置Codeigniter网站。我想,我收到了禁止访问的错误,但后来纠正了这一点。

我已经在配置文件中计算出基本网址,以便:

$config['base_url'] = 'http://websitename.com/';

index_page是:

$config['index_page'] = '';

URI 为:

$config['uri_protocol'] = '自动';

菜单中的链接未正确重定向。他们只是重新加载索引页。在Firebug中,这是我看到的页面链接之一:

https://websitename.com/index.php?module/rekap_tl

也许这足以理解这里的麻烦。我正在实时服务器上使用它。

非常感谢任何和所有的帮助。

您可以像配置代码点火器 $config['base_url'] = '';//将其留空,以便代码点火器可以自行猜测,设置$config['index_page'] = 'index.php';并在打开application/config/autoload.php之后$config['uri_protocol'] = 'AUTO';,然后添加 url 帮助程序类以自动加载辅助程序$autoload['helper'] = array('url');之后您可以在菜单中使用"<?php echo base_url(); ?>index.php/controller/method/args"希望这会有所帮助